Pineal region tumors are rare and a heterogenous group of primary central nervous system tumors which are primarily classified as germ cell tumors and non-germ cell tumors. Chemotherapy and radiotherapy as the primary treatment modalities have been reported to result in good outcomes. We discuss the case of a young girl who presented to our emergency department in an unconscious state and had a large lesion in the posterior third ventricular region, but without any associated hydrocephalus which could explain her stuporous state. Given the rapid decline in her sensorium, we were faced with the difficult choice between surgical decompression of the tumor and a trial of rescue chemotherapy following histopathological confirmation through biopsy. She underwent an open biopsy followed by chemotherapy in a neurosurgical intensive care unit despite her poor Karnofsky performance score. She improved after chemotherapy and her tumor decreased in size significantly over time. We highlight the role of chemotherapy administered in the neurosurgical ICU to an unconscious patient with a large chemoresponsive tumor leading to rapid shrinkage of the lesion and gradual improvement in the sensorium of the patient.

The developing hippocampus is highly sensitive to chemotherapy and cranial radiation treatments for pediatric cancers, yet little is known about the effects that cancer treatents have on specific hippocampal subfields. Here, we examined hippocampal subfield volumes in 29 pediatric brain tumor survivors treated with cranial radiation and chemotherapy, and 30 healthy developing children and adolescents. We also examined associations between hippocampal subfield volumes and short-term verbal memory. Hippocampal subfields (Cornus Ammonis (CA) 1, CA2-3, dentate gyrus (DG)-CA4, stratum radiatum-lacunosum-moleculare, and subiculum) were segmented using the Multiple Automatically Generated Templates for Different Brains automated segmentation algorithm. Neuropsychological assessment of short-term verbal associative memory was performed in a subset of brain tumor survivors (N = 11) and typically developing children (N = 16), using the Children's Memory Scale or Wechsler's Memory Scale-third edition. Repeated measures analysis of variance showed that pediatric brain tumor survivors had significantly smaller DG-CA4, CA1, CA2-3, and stratum radiatum-lacunosum-moleculare volumes compared with typically developing children. Verbal memory performance was positively related to DG-CA4, CA1, and stratum radiatum-lacunosum-moleculare volumes in pediatric brain tumor survivors. Unlike the brain tumor survivors, there were no associations between subfield volumes and memory in typically developing children and adolescents. These data suggest that specific subfields of the hippocampus may be vulnerable to brain cancer treatments, and may contribute to impaired episodic memory following brain cancer treatment in childhood.

INTRODUCTION: The usual endoscopic approach in the management of pineal region tumours consists of inserting the scope into the frontal horn of the lateral ventricle and advancing it through the foramen of Monro into the third ventricle. We report the case of a patient with a pineal tumour on whom we used an endoscopic approach through the ventricular atrium to obtain a biopsy by opening the choroidal fissure. CLINICAL CASE: This young 25-year-old man presented with headache and double vision. Papilloedema and Parinaud's syndrome were found on physical examination. Cranial magnetic resonance revealed a pineal mass and hydrocephalus. We initially performed a third ventriculostomy and a tumour biopsy through a frontal burr hole. The tissue sample was not useful for pathological diagnosis and we decided to perform a second endoscopic biopsy. CONCLUSIONS: The endoscopic approach to pineal region masses, reaching the ventricular atrium through a parietal burr hole and opening the choroidal fissure, makes it possible to take a biopsy using a single endoscopic approach without needing to cross other ventricular structures.

Pineal parenchymal tumors (PPTs) are rare neoplasms which occupy less than 1% of primary CNS tumors. Because of their rare incidence, previous reports on PPTs are limited in number and the useful molecular markers for deciding histological grading and even selecting chemotherapy are undetermined. In this study, we conducted immunohistochemical analysis of 12 PPT specimens, especially for expression of O6-methylguanine DNA methyltransferase (MGMT) to assess whether temozolomide (TMZ) could serve as a possible alternative therapy for PPTs. We analyzed 12 PPTs, consisting of three pineocytomas, six PPTs of intermediate differentiation (PPTIDs), and three pineoblastomas. Immunohistochemical analysis was performed using antibodies against MGMT, synaptophysin, neurofilament protein (NF), p53, and neuronal nuclear antigen (NeuN). Immunohistochemically, 11 out of 12 cases were positive for MGMT. The mean MIB-1 labeling index was less than 1% in pineocytoma, 3.5% in PPTID, and 10.5% in pineoblastoma. All 12 cases were positive for synaptophysin and 11 cases, except one PPTID case, showed positive for NF. Nuclear staining of NeuN was negative in all cases although cytoplasmic staining of NeuN was observed in five cases. No case was positive for p53. Eleven out of 12 cases of PPTs demonstrated MGMT expression, suggesting chemoresistancy to TMZ treatment. This is the first report showing MGMT expression in PPTs. In addition, MIB-1 labeling index correlated with WHO grade, although the immunoreactivity of synaptophysin, NF, NeuN and p53 did not correlate with the histological grade.

BACKGROUND: Trilateral retinoblastoma has been lethal in virtually all cases previously reported. We describe a series of 13 patients treated with intensive chemotherapy, defined as the intention to include high-dose chemotherapy with autologous hematopoietic stem cell rescue. PROCEDURE: Induction chemotherapy generally included vincristine, cisplatin or carboplatin, cyclophosphamide, and etoposide. Hematopoietic stem cells typically were harvested after the first or second cycle of induction chemotherapy, usually from peripheral blood. High-dose chemotherapy regimens were thiotepa-based (n = 7) or melphalan and cyclophosphamide (n = 3). RESULTS: Trilateral sites were pineal (n = 11) and suprasellar (n = 2); 7 patients had localized (M-0) disease and six had leptomeningeal dissemination (M-1+). Five patients had trilateral retinoblastoma at original diagnosis of intra-ocular retinoblastoma; eight later developed trilateral disease at a median of 35 months (range 3-60 months) following diagnosis of intra-ocular retinoblastoma. One patient died of toxicity (septicemia and multi-organ system failure) during induction and three developed disease progression prior to high-dose chemotherapy. Nine patients received high-dose chemotherapy at a median of 5 months (range 4-9) post-diagnosis of trilateral disease. Five patients survive event-free at a median of 77 months (range 36-104 months) and never received external beam radiation therapy. Four of seven patients with M-0 disease survive event-free versus only one of six patients with M-1+ disease. CONCLUSIONS: Intensive chemotherapy is potentially curative for some patients with trilateral retinoblastoma, especially those with M-0 disease.

Trilateral retinoblastoma (TRB) is a rare condition characterized by an intracranial neuroblastic tumor associated with bilateral or unilateral retinoblastoma (RB). The outcome is almost always fatal. An 18-month-old patient with familial bilateral RB was referred for a pineal lesion detected on a screening by magnetic resonance imaging. The child, considered inoperable by 2 different neurosurgical teams, was treated with conventional chemotherapy (methotrexate, vincristine, vepeside, cyclophosphamide, and carboplatin) plus tandem transplantation (vepeside/carboplatin and thiotepa/mephalan) followed by local radiotherapy. At 80 months from the diagnosis of TRB, the patient is alive and in complete remission, with no neuropsychologic consequences. An early and aggressive treatment may improve the prognosis of TRB.

BACKGROUND: The growing teratoma syndrome (GTS) consists of a mature teratoma paradoxically enlarging during or after chemotherapy for malignant nongerminomatous germ cell tumors. METHODS AND RESULTS: We report two cases of GTS occurring in association with NSGCT of the pineal gland. Although an unusual event, clinicians and radiologists should be aware of its natural history. CONCLUSIONS: When normalized tumor markers after chemotherapy are associated with imaging features of a growing mass, the hypothesis of GTS must be taken in consideration. When early diagnosed, GTS can be managed surgically with good results.

Pineoblastoma is a rare pediatric cancer induced by germline mutations in the tumor suppressors RB1 or DICER1. Presence of leptomeningeal metastases is indicative of poor prognosis. Here we report that inactivation of Rb plus p53 via a WAP-Cre transgene, commonly used to target the mammary gland during pregnancy, induces metastatic pineoblastoma resembling the human disease with 100% penetrance. A stabilizing mutation rather than deletion of p53 accelerates metastatic dissemination. Deletion of Dicer1 plus p53 via WAP-Cre also predisposes to pineoblastoma, albeit with lower penetrance. In silico analysis predicts tricyclic antidepressants such as nortriptyline as potential therapeutics for both pineoblastoma models. Nortriptyline disrupts the lysosome, leading to accumulation of non-functional autophagosome, cathepsin B release and pineoblastoma cell death. Nortriptyline further synergizes with the antineoplastic drug gemcitabine to effectively suppress pineoblastoma in our preclinical models, offering new modality for this lethal childhood malignancy.

We report the case of an adult patient with pineoblastoma (PBL) who had a complete radiographic response following treatment with vorinostat and retinoic acid. This regimen was used to treat bulky residual tumor that persisted despite radiation therapy (RT) and two cycles of cytotoxic chemotherapy. Vorinostat and retinoic acid were chosen as an alternative to cytotoxic chemotherapy, which our patient was unable to tolerate, based on preclinical data suggesting efficacy of this combination. MRI demonstrated a complete response to this regimen, which continues to remain stable without evidence of recurrence.

We present a case of synchronous involvement of the pineal and suprasellar regions by a mixed germ cell tumor comprising germinoma and yolk sac tumor components, with a predominant angiomatous component. To our knowledge, it is the first case of this nature to be reported in the literature. Usually, synchronous lesions of this kind are pure germinomas, and some clinicians will forgo a biopsy and assume a germinoma histology if the serum beta-human chorionic gonadotrophin (HCG) is <50 IU/l and the alpha-fetoprotein (AFP) is within normal limits. Secondly, if a biopsy is performed on a lesion that has a prominent angiomatous component, the diagnostic germ cell tumor may be missed at the time of the biopsy. In order to alert clinicians and pathologists to this rare entity, the case is discussed with particular reference to difficulties that were encountered in rendering an accurate diagnosis, and the associated management implications.

BACKGROUND/AIM: Pineoblastoma of the adult age is an uncommon tumor with only 200 cases reported. A standardized approach for an optimal adjuvant strategy is currently lacking. The case presented herein also deals with the issue of central nervous system tumors in pregnancy. CASE REPORT: A 21-year-old pregnant woman presented with massive hydrocephalus due to a mass in the pineal region detected with MRI. After positioning an urgent ventricular derivation, a cesarean section was performed. During a third ventriculocisternostomy, a biopsy revealed a pineoblastoma. After a maximal safe resection, postoperative craniospinal irradiation for a total dose of 36 Gy plus a sequential boost to the tumor bed to 54 Gy, and adjuvant chemotherapy with CDDP plus CCNU plus vincristine were performed. After one year, the patient is alive with no evidence of disease. CONCLUSION: The use of adjuvant radio-chemotherapy provided excellent outcomes in our case. The advanced gestational age facilitated the choice of the therapeutic strategy.

PURPOSE: To assess the efficacy of upfront chemotherapy followed by response-adapted reduced-dose/reduced-volume radiotherapy (RT) for intracranial germinoma. MATERIALS AND METHODS: Ninety-one patients from five institutions were registered in the KSPNO G051/G081 Protocol. Germinomas were classified as solitary or multiple/disseminated diseases, and upfront chemotherapy was administered. For all patients with multiple or disseminated disease, and patients with partial response after chemotherapy, 19.5-24 Gy of craniospinal irradiation plus 10.8-19.8 Gy of tumor bed boost were planned. For patients with complete response (CR), reduced-dose RT (30.6 Gy) was planned, along with a reduced field for solitary lesions. RESULTS: The median patient age was 14 (range, 3-30) years. Sixty-five patients (71.4%) had a solitary lesion. The median follow-up duration was 67.9 (range, 6.6-119.3) months. Recurrence was not observed in 32 patients in the protocol compliant group. Four patients (4.4%) in the protocol non-compliant group experienced relapse after CR and one patient died of the disease. The 5-year and 7-year overall survival rates were 98.8% and 98.8%, while the corresponding event-free survival rates were 96.6% and 93.8%, respectively. All three patients with basal ganglia germinomas who were treated with local RT experienced recurrence outside the RT field. Among the 23 patients with pineal or suprasellar lesions who received whole-ventricle RT, there was no recurrence. CONCLUSIONS: Currently used upfront chemotherapy followed by reduced-dose, reduced-volume RT appears acceptable, when whole-ventricle RT for pineal or suprasellar tumors and, at minimum, whole-brain RT for basal ganglia/thalamus lesions are applied.

Trilateral retinoblastoma (TRb) presents a management challenge, since intracranial tumours are seldom times resectable and quickly disseminate. However, there are no risk factors to predict the final outcome in each patient. OBJECTIVE: To evaluate minimal disseminated disease (MDD) in the bone marrow (BM) and the cerebrospinal fluid (CSF) at diagnosis and during follow-up and reviewing its potential impact in the outcome of patients with TRb. METHODS AND ANALYSIS: We evaluated MDD in five patients with TRb, detecting the mRNA of CRX and/or GD2, in samples from BM and CSF, obtained at diagnosis, follow-up and relapse. RESULTS: Treatment involved intensive systemic chemotherapy in four patients, one did not receive this treatment and died of progression of the disease. Two patients underwent stem cell rescue. Three patients had leptomeningeal relapse and died. One patient remains disease-free for 84 months. RB1 mutations were identified in the five patients, all of them were null mutations. At diagnosis, one patient had tumour cells in the CSF, and none had the BM involved. Only one case of four presented MDD during follow-up in the CSF, without concomitant detection in the BM. On leptomeningeal relapse, no case had MDD in the BM. In all these cases, cells in the CSF were positive for GD2 and/or CRX. CONCLUSION: CSF dissemination always concluded in the death of the patient, without concomitant systemic dissemination denoting the importance of increasing treatment directed to the CSF compartment. The MDD presence could indicate a forthcoming relapse.

The authors report a case of a recurrent intracranial germinoma along the site of an endoscopic third ventriculostomy (ETV) after complete local tumor control using 3D conformal radiation therapy. A 13-year-old girl presented with sudden left upward gaze limitation for 4 days. A pineal region tumor and obstructive hydrocephalus were noted on magnetic resonance (MR) images. An ETV and tumor biopsy procedure were performed, which revealed the lesion to be a germinoma. The patient's visual symptoms and hydrocephalus disappeared postoperatively. Chemotherapy using cisplatin, etoposide, vincristine, and cyclophosphamide was initiated on postoperative Day 10. An MR image obtained 10 weeks after surgery and 2 weeks after chemotherapy revealed a significant (> 50%) reduction of the lesion. Radiation therapy was administered at 50.4 Gy to the target and 36 Gy to the periphery. Ten months after surgery, an MR image revealed further shrinkage of the tumor mass. One year after surgery, follow-up MR imaging demonstrated a small mass lesion at the entry site of the ETV, measuring 1.0 x 1.4 x 1.5 cm. An operation was performed to remove the small lesion, and pathological findings revealed it to be of the same histology as the primary tumor.

Extraneural metastases of intracranial germinoma are rarely reported. The authors describe the first case of metastatic lung germinoma of the thoracic spine. A 27-year-old man presented with right shoulder pain and right upper limb weakness. He had a history of repetitive radiation therapy - nine (whole-abdomen; 15Gy), 12 (whole brain; 30Gy, whole spine 42Gy) and 14 years ago (local; 32Gy) - for abdominal metastasis, temporal and fourth ventricle metastasis and spinal dissemination and metastatic pineal germinoma, respectively. Magnetic resonance imaging revealed a lung mass invading the thoracic spine that was diagnosed as a germinoma by tumor biopsy. He was treated by irradiation with 54Gy and two cycles of chemotherapy with cisplatin and etoposide. He did not have any sign of tumor eight years later.

Background: Pineoblastoma is a rare pineal region brain tumor. Treatment strategies have reflected those for other malignant embryonal brain tumors. Patients and Methods: Original prospective treatment and outcome data from international trial groups were pooled. Cox regression models were developed considering treatment elements as time-dependent covariates. Results: Data on 135 patients with pineoblastoma aged 0.01-20.7 (median 4.9) years were analyzed. Median observation time was 7.3 years. Favorable prognostic factors were age ≥4 years (hazard ratio [HR] for progression-free survival [PFS] 0.270, P < .001) and administration of radiotherapy (HR for PFS 0.282, P < .001). Metastatic disease (HR for PFS 2.015, P = .006), but not postoperative residual tumor, was associated with unfavorable prognosis. In 57 patients <4 years old, 5-year PFS/overall survival (OS) were 11 ± 4%/12 ± 4%. Two patients survived after chemotherapy only, while 3 of 16 treated with craniospinal irradiation (CSI) with boost, and 3 of 5 treated with high-dose chemotherapy (HDCT) and local radiotherapy survived. In 78 patients aged ≥4 years, PFS/OS were 72 ± 7%/73 ± 7% for patients without metastases, and 50 ± 10%/55 ± 10% with metastases. Seventy-three patients received radiotherapy (48 conventionally fractionated CSI, median dose 35.0 [18.0-45.0] Gy, 19 hyperfractionated CSI, 6 local radiotherapy), with (n = 68) or without (n = 6) chemotherapy. The treatment sequence had no impact; application of HDCT had weak impact on survival in older patients. Conclusion: Survival is poor in young children treated without radiotherapy. In these patients, combination of HDCT and local radiotherapy may warrant further evaluation in the absence of more specific or targeted treatments. CSI combined with chemotherapy is effective for older non-metastatic patients.

Pineal parenchymal tumour of intermediate differentiation (PPTID) in adults is rare and a treatment strategy for this condition has not yet been established. We present a case of an elderly patient treated with postoperative adjuvant therapy using radio- and chemotherapy. This 60-year-old man presented with a 3-month history of memory disturbance, gait instability and double vision. Computed tomography and magnetic resonance imaging demonstrated a mass in the pineal region that suggested a malignant tumour. Partial removal of the tumour was undertaken via the right occipital transtentorial approach. The histological diagnosis was PPTID. Postoperative radio- and chemotherapy were administered, with a good response. Little is known about the clinical behaviour of PPTID in adults. Our treatment plan indicates one effective option for the management of such tumours.

AIM: Pineal tumors represent uncommon intracranial tumors with highly diverse histologic subtypes. There still exists a controversy in literature about what influences overall survival and outcome. MATERIAL AND METHODS: We present the results of 48 patients with pineal tumor treated either by stereotactic biopsy followed by adjuvant therapy (23 patients) or open surgical resection without (18 patients) or with (7 patients) adjuvant therapy in Shohada Tajrish Hospital, Iran (1993-2008). RESULTS: Unremarkable pathology yield was 3/23 in the biopsy and 1/25 in the surgical group. Perioperative mortality and morbidity were 4.3% and 0% in the biopsy group and 32.0% and 4.0% in the surgical group. Analysis showed that age, gender, cranial nerve deficit, motor deficit, preoperative Karnofsky Performance Score (KPS), midbrain involvement, and brain stem involvement had no effect on neither perioperative mortality nor long-term survival, while local invasion and pineocytoma pathology increased perioperative mortality and presence of hydrocephalus and pineoblastoma pathology significantly decreased long-term survival. Hospitalization length was shorter in the stereotactic biopsy plus adjuvant therapy group. CONCLUSION: The results of the study suggests that although gross total resection is the standard of care in most pineal tumors nowadays, stereotactic biopsy followed by adjuvant therapy may still be a safe and viable option.

CLINICAL CASE: A 33-year-old male diagnosed with Parinaud's syndrome, exotropia and post-papillary oedema optic atrophy in his left eye. A pineal germinoma was diagnosed after performing neuroimaging scans and a stereotactic biopsy. He was treated with chemotherapy and radiotherapy, showing a complete pathological response. The Parinaud's syndrome persists one year after diagnosis and the patient has refused to have strabismus surgery. DISCUSSION: Parinaud's syndrome consists of a supranuclear vertical gaze palsy resulting from damage to the midbrain tectum. The involvement of adjacent structures leads to the «Parinaud-plus¼ syndrome. When a Parinaud's syndrome is accompanied by diplopia («Parinaud-plus¼ syndrome), extension of the injury into adjacent areas must be considered.
